  4. He probably has a parasite called Giardia. Our daughter who came from the same baby house had it also. In fact, I've talked to several adoptive moms with kids from the same place, and they all had it--probably something in the water there. Some have horrible diarrhea with it, some just like Maks have big poops. It's easily treated with a course of special antibiotics. Our IA doctor automatically screened for it at our 1st visit. I know that you are probably done with the poop situation now, but for the next time- The reason people get the runs when on antibiotics is because the antibiotic kills all the good bacteria in the intestins. Next time he's on antibiotics, have him eat Activia or go to the health food stor and get some acidophilus. If you get the powder, sprinkle it on yogurt or applesauce and give it to him on an empty stomach a couple hours after he's had the antibiotic. Try to give it to him a couple times a day.
